Responsibilities

  • Curriculum Design & Development
  • Design and develop comprehensive WSQ and non-WSQ courseware, encompassing learner guides, facilitator manuals, and assessment plans, strictly mapped to SSG's Technical Skills and Competencies (TSCs).
  • Employ Adult Learning Principles to create engaging, empathetic, and highly effective blended learning experiences.
  • Integrate modern technology including AI and innovative methodologies into curricula to create engaging learning environments and enhance learner outcomes.
  • Conduct regular curriculum reviews and spearhead updates to ensure content remains highly relevant to industry demands and client capabilities.
  • Quality Management & Compliance
  • Oversee the end-to-end quality assurance processes for all WSQ and non-WSQ programmes, ensuring absolute compliance with SSG's stringent guidelines and audit requirements.
  • Formulate and implement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) aligned with the Training Provider Quality Assessment (TPQA) framework.
  • Manage the Continuous Improvement Review (CIR) process, maintaining meticulous documentation and evidence for external audits.
  • Conduct routine internal audits on training delivery and assessment protocols, providing constructive, actionable feedback to adult educators and assessors.
  • Data-Driven Evaluation & Strategy
  • Leverage quantitative and qualitative industry & learner data to formulate actionable recommendations for curriculum enhancement and pedagogical shifts.
  • Partner proactively with clients and internal stakeholders to understand their core 'Why', ensuring training outcomes directly resolve their operational and strategic challenges.
  • Requirements & Qualifications
  • Essential Certification: WSQ DACE or DDDLP certification is required
  • Experience: Minimum of 2-3 years of proven experience in WSQ curriculum development, instructional design, and quality assurance within a Singapore Approved Training Organisation (ATO).
  • Technical Knowledge: Deep understanding of the Skills Framework (SFw), TP Gateway, and current SSG policies regarding funding and compliance. Experience in developing e-learning content is an advantage.
  • Attributes: Highly analytical with a data-driven mindset, detail-oriented, and equipped with excellent stakeholder management skills. Must possess the ability to communicate complex regulatory frameworks clearly and concisely.
  • Industry Knowledge: Experience in built environment or sustainability is an advantage.
